§ 29-5-212 — Obstruction of shooting, hunting, fishing and trapping

Oklahoma·Title 29 Game And Fish

prohibited - Landowner's rights - Penalties - Exemptions.

A.A person may not willfully obstruct or impede the participation of any individual in the lawful activity of shooting, hunting, fishing or trapping in this state. Provided, that nothing in this section shall prohibit a landowner or lessee from exercising their lawful rights of prohibiting hunting, fishing or trapping on their land, or any other legal right.
B.Any person violating the provisions of this section shall be guilty of a misdemeanor, and, upon conviction thereof, shall be punished by a fine of not less than One Hundred Dollars ($100.00) nor more than Five Hundred Dollars ($500.00).

Legislative History

Laws 1987, c. 142, § 1, eff. July 1, 1987; Laws 1991, c. 182, § 33, eff. Sept. 1, 1991.
